Turtle Mountain Band of Chippewa Indians Tribal Code.

36.04.020 Other Sanctions

(a) Prosecution for the offense of Elder Abuse shall not preclude prosecution for any other offense arising from the same circumstances.

(b) A person convicted of Elder Abuse shall not be released from custody for community service.

(c) A person convicted of Elder Abuse shall not be released from custody to attend funeral or wake services unless said services are for a member of the person's immediate family and shall be at the discretion and condition of the Turtle Mountain Tribal Court. Immediate family shall mean husband, wife, son, daughter, brother, sister, father, mother, aunt, uncle or grandparent.

(d) A person convicted of Elder Abuse shall not be released from custody for the holidays.

(e) A person convicted of Elder Abuse may be released for employment at the discretion and condition of the Turtle Mountain Tribal court.

(f) A person found guilty of the crime of Elder Abuse may also be ordered to pay the reasonable costs of the person's prosecution.
